Dreadknight: An Underrated Iron Man Villain Receives a Much-Needed Upgrade in the Ultimate Universe

Dreadknight rides on his black winged horse.

While Dreadknight is known for his eerie skeletal mask and ominous equestrian companion, his original garb closely mirrors Doctor Doom’s iconic aesthetic. In fact, Doctor Doom had a hand in shaping Dreadknight, as he effectively punished Bram Velsing by welding the character’s mask to his face. Despite this intriguing backstory, Dreadknight’s look pales in comparison to Iron Man’s grand attire. The Ultimate Universe’s redesign provided Dreadknight with an innovative, high-tech suit that placed him on par with Iron Man, a crucial update that deserves a place in Marvel’s Earth-616 universe.

The revamped Dreadknight maintains the signature skeleton mask but trades in his medieval-inspired armor for a bold new suit powered by Stark Industries technology. This bold new look significantly enhances his menace, allowing him to compete effectively against Iron Man.

In Ultimate Armor Wars #3, Dreadknight showcases a formidable arsenal, complete with rocket launchers and advanced energy weapons. This modernized equipment allows him to challenge Iron Man directly. Moreover, Dreadknight’s new origin story closely ties him to Tony Stark, as he utilizes pilfered Stark technology to construct his powerful suit. This integral connection adds depth to Dreadknight’s character, making him a relevant player in Iron Man’s universe.
